Weak operator Daugavet property and weakly open sets in tensor product spaces

We obtain new progress about the diameter two property and the Daugavet property in tensor product spaces. Namely, the main results of the paper are:

If \(X^*\) X has the WODP, then \(X \widehat{\otimes }_\varepsilon Y\) X ^ ε Y has the DD2P for any Banach space Y.

If X has the WODP, then \(X \widehat{\otimes }_\pi Y\) X ^ π Y has the DD2P for any Banach space Y.

If \(X^*\) X and \(Y^*\) Y have the WODP then \(X \widehat{\otimes }_\varepsilon Y\) X ^ ε Y has the Daugavet property.

The above improve many results in the literature and establish progress on some open questions.
